io_uring: mitigate unlikely iopoll lag

We have requests like IORING_OP_FILES_UPDATE that don't go through
->iopoll_list but get completed in place under ->uring_lock, and so
after dropping the lock io_iopoll_check() should expect that some CQEs
might have get completed in a meanwhile.

Currently such events won't be accounted in @nr_events, and the loop
will continue to poll even if there is enough of CQEs. It shouldn't be a
problem as it's not likely to happen and so, but not nice either. Just
return earlier in this case, it should be enough.

fs/io_uring.c

index 8f2a669..7167c61 100644 (file)
@@ -2356,11 +2356,15 @@ static int io_iopoll_check(struct io_ring_ctx *ctx, long min)
                 * very same mutex.
                 */
                if (list_empty(&ctx->iopoll_list)) {
+                       u32 tail = ctx->cached_cq_tail;
+
                        mutex_unlock(&ctx->uring_lock);
                        io_run_task_work();
                        mutex_lock(&ctx->uring_lock);
 
-                       if (list_empty(&ctx->iopoll_list))
+                       /* some requests don't go through iopoll_list */
+                       if (tail != ctx->cached_cq_tail ||
+                           list_empty(&ctx->iopoll_list))
                                break;
                }
                ret = io_do_iopoll(ctx, &nr_events, min);
